一、商品关联推荐策略
1. 基于用户行为的关联推荐
- 数据采集:通过埋点收集用户浏览、加购、购买行为,分析商品间的共现关系(如“购买牛奶的用户常购买鸡蛋”)。
- 算法应用:
- 协同过滤:挖掘用户相似性(如“喜欢有机蔬菜的用户也喜欢进口水果”)。
- 序列模式挖掘:识别用户购买路径(如“先买牛排,再买黑胡椒酱”)。
- 深度学习模型:使用Wide & Deep、DIN等模型捕捉用户动态兴趣。
- 场景化推荐:
- 套餐推荐:将高频搭配商品组合(如“火锅食材套餐”),设置折扣价。
- 季节/节日推荐:冬季推荐“热饮+坚果”,节日推荐“礼盒装水果”。
- 补货提醒:对周期性商品(如大米、纸巾)推送“上次购买后30天,是否需要补货?”
2. 基于商品属性的关联推荐
- 品类关联:
- 互补品:如“三文鱼+柠檬+芥末”。
- 替代品:如“车厘子缺货时推荐草莓”。
- 价格带关联:
- 高客单价引导:用户浏览普通苹果时,推荐“进口蛇果+礼盒包装”。
- 满减凑单:满100减20时,推荐“还差30元,是否需要加购零食?”
3. 实时推荐引擎
- 技术实现:
- 使用Flink/Spark Streaming处理实时行为数据。
- 结合Redis缓存热门关联规则,降低响应延迟。
- 触发时机:
- 商品详情页:展示“常一起购买”商品。
- 购物车页:推荐“凑单满减”商品。
- 支付成功页:推荐“下次可能购买”商品(如“您上次购买的鸡蛋快吃完了,是否需要回购?”)。
二、万象源码部署优化
1. 源码架构设计
- 微服务拆分:
- 推荐服务:独立部署,负责算法计算和规则引擎。
- 用户画像服务:存储用户标签(如“宝妈”“健身爱好者”)。
- 商品服务:维护商品属性、库存、价格。
- 技术栈建议:
- 后端:Spring Cloud + MySQL/TiDB(高并发场景)。
- 推荐引擎:Python(TensorFlow/PyTorch)+ Go(高性能接口)。
- 前端:React/Vue + 移动端H5适配。
2. 性能优化
- 缓存策略:
- 使用Redis缓存用户历史行为、热门推荐结果。
- 对低频更新数据(如商品分类)设置长TTL。
- 异步处理:
- 用户行为日志通过Kafka异步写入分析系统。
- 推荐结果预计算(如夜间批量生成),减少实时计算压力。
- AB测试框架:
- 部署多套推荐策略,通过流量分割对比效果(如点击率、客单价)。
- 使用Feature Store管理实验变量。
3. 部署方案
- 容器化部署:
- 使用Docker + Kubernetes实现弹性伸缩。
- 对推荐服务设置HPA(水平自动扩缩容)。
- 混合云架构:
- 私有云部署核心数据(用户画像、交易记录)。
- 公有云部署推荐计算(按需扩容)。
- 监控告警:
- Prometheus + Grafana监控接口响应时间、错误率。
- 设置阈值告警(如推荐接口延迟>500ms时触发扩容)。
三、提升客单价的具体玩法
1. 动态定价与捆绑销售
- 智能折扣:
- 对关联商品设置“第二件半价”(如“买一箱牛奶,第二箱立减50%”)。
- 使用强化学习动态调整折扣力度。
- 组合套餐:
- 将高毛利与低毛利商品组合(如“进口牛排+国产调料”)。
- 套餐价低于单品总和(如原价200元,套餐价180元)。
2. 社交裂变与会员体系
- 拼团推荐:
- 用户购买生鲜时,推荐“邀请好友拼团,享8折”。
- 对拼团商品设置专属关联推荐(如“拼团买龙虾,推荐配菜套餐”)。
- 会员专属推荐:
- 铂金会员推送“高端食材+私人厨师服务”。
- 普通会员推送“性价比组合”。
3. 场景化营销
- 家庭场景:
- 用户购买婴儿奶粉时,推荐“辅食+儿童零食”。
- 健康场景:
- 用户购买沙拉时,推荐“低卡酱料+运动装备”。
四、效果评估与迭代
1. 核心指标:
- 客单价提升率(对比实验前后)。
- 关联商品点击率、转化率。
- 用户复购率(通过推荐触达的用户)。
2. 迭代方向:
- 每周分析低效推荐规则,优化算法参数。
- 每月上线新场景(如“露营食材推荐”)。
五、案例参考
- 盒马鲜生:通过“30分钟达”服务,在购物车页推荐“缺货商品替代品”,客单价提升15%。
- 每日优鲜:使用深度学习模型预测用户需求,推荐“即将用完”商品,复购率提升20%。
通过上述策略,生鲜商城可实现关联推荐的精准化与系统的高可用性,最终提升客单价与用户LTV(生命周期价值)。